Мазмұны:
- 1 -қадам: бейне
- 2 -қадам: Pi орнату
- 3 -қадам: камераны дайындау
- 4 -қадам: PIR датчигін қосу
- 5 -қадам: Кодекс
- 6 -қадам: оны іске қосыңыз
Бейне: Pi Guardian: 6 қадам (суреттермен)
2024 Автор: John Day | [email protected]. Соңғы өзгертілген: 2024-01-30 10:27
Сіз өзіңіздің Хэллоуин кәмпитіңізді ұрлайтын адамды ұстағыңыз келді ме? Немесе сіздің тоңазытқышты жалғыз қалдырмайтын үйдегі тітіркендіргіш туралы не деуге болады? Raspberry Pi 3, Pi Camera және PIR сенсорының көмегімен мұның бәрі қазір мүмкін болды. Оны бақылау қажет жерге қойыңыз және қылмыскердің фотосуреті электрондық поштаға жіберіңіз.
1 -қадам: бейне
2 -қадам: Pi орнату
DFRobot маған хабарласып, Raspberry Pi 3 және Raspberry Pi камера модулін жіберді. Мен қораптарды ашқаннан кейін мен SD картасын орнату арқылы жұмысқа кірдім. Алдымен мен Raspberry Pi жүктеулер бетіне кірдім және Raspbian -ның соңғы нұсқасын жүктедім. Содан кейін мен файлды шығарып, оны ыңғайлы каталогқа қойдым. SD картасына.img файлын көшіру/қою мүмкін емес, оны картаға «жазу» керек. ОЖ кескінін оңай тасымалдау үшін Etcher.io сияқты жанып тұрған утилитаны жүктеуге болады. SD картасында.img файлы болғаннан кейін мен оны Raspberry Pi -ге салып, оған қуат бердім. Шамамен 50 секундтан кейін мен сымды ажыратып, SD картасын алып тастадым. Содан кейін мен SD картасын компьютерге қайта салып, «жүктеу» каталогына кірдім. Мен блокнотты ашып, оны NO кеңейтімі бар «ssh» деп аталатын бос файл ретінде сақтадым. Менде «wpa_supplicant.conf» деп аталатын файл бар және оған осы мәтінді қойдым: network = {ssid = psk =} Содан кейін мен картаны сақтап шығардым және оны қайтадан Raspberry Pi 3 -ке қойдым. SSH пайдалану және WiFi желісіне қосылу.
3 -қадам: камераны дайындау
Әдепкі бойынша, камерада Pi-де өшірілген, сондықтан мәзірді шығару үшін sudo raspi-config түріндегі терминалды ашу керек. «Интерфейс опцияларына» өтіңіз, содан кейін камераны қосыңыз. Енді «Аяқтауды» таңдап, камераның модулінің таспалы кабелін Pi -нің дұрыс аймағына енгізіңіз.
4 -қадам: PIR датчигін қосу
PIR сенсоры пассивті инфрақызылды білдіреді, яғни ол жылуды анықтай алады, сондықтан адамдар оның алдында қозғалады. Қосылу үшін тек 3 сым бар: VCC, GND және OUTPUT. VCC 3.3V -ге қосылады, әрине GND -ден GND -ге, және OUTPUT Pi -ге 4 -ші пинге (BCM нөмірленуі) қосылады.
5 -қадам: Кодекс
Мен осы жоба бетіне кодты қостым, сондықтан оны көшіру/қою ғана қажет, бірақ бір аулау. Негізгі есептік жазбаның құпия сөзін айтпағанда, құпия сөздерді қарапайым мәтінмен сақтау жақсы тәжірибе емес. Сондықтан Google есептік жазбалары бетіне өтіп, қауіпсіздікті, содан кейін қолданба құпия сөздерін таңдауға болады. «Raspberry Pi электрондық поштасы» деп аталатын жаңасын қосыңыз және кодқа 16 таңбалы құпия сөзді көшіріп қойыңыз. Бұл қауіпсіздікті жақсарту арқылы құпия сөзді жоюға мүмкіндік береді. Қолданбаның құпия сөзін орнату үшін Google есептік жазбаңыздың электрондық пошта мекенжайын енгізіңіз.
6 -қадам: оны іске қосыңыз
Енді кодты sudo python.py теру арқылы іске қосыңыз, мен құрылғыны Хэллоуин кәмпитінің жаңа қоймасына қарама -қарсы қойдым, егер біреу оны ұрламақшы болса.
Ұсынылған:
Arduino басқарылатын робот - екі қадам: 13 қадам (суреттермен)
Arduino басқарылатын роботты екіжақты: Мен әрқашан роботтарға қызығатынмын, әсіресе адамның іс -әрекетіне еліктеуге тырысатын. Бұл қызығушылық мені жаяу жүруге және жүгіруге еліктей алатын екіжақты робот құрастыруға және дамытуға талпындырды. Бұл нұсқаулықта мен сізге көрсетемін
Steampunked Dream Guardian түнгі жарығы: 9 қадам (суреттермен)
Steampunked Dream Guardian Night Light: Баршаңызға сәлем Менің жақын досым бірнеше апта бұрын сүйіктісіне үйлену сыйлығын (әрине сақинадан басқа!) Жасауымды өтінді. Екеуі де мен сияқты, ерікті өрт сөндірушілер және олар Steampunk объектілерін жақсы көреді. Менің досым үй туралы ойлады
Arduino Hang Guardian - Arduino Watchdog Timer оқулығы: 6 қадам
Arduino Hang Guardian - Arduino Watchdog Timer оқулығы: Барлығына сәлем, бұл бәрімізде болады. Сіз жоба жасайсыз, сенсорлардың барлығын ынтамен байланыстырасыз, кенеттен Arduino өшіп қалады және ешқандай кіріс өңделмейді. «Не болып жатыр?», Сіз сұрайсыз және кодты тексере бастайсыз, тек қайталау үшін
Болт - DIY сымсыз зарядтау түнгі сағаты (6 қадам): 6 қадам (суреттермен)
Болт - DIY сымсыз зарядтау түнгі сағаты (6 қадам): Индуктивті зарядтау (сымсыз зарядтау немесе сымсыз зарядтау деп те аталады) - сымсыз қуат беру түрі. Ол портативті құрылғыларды электрмен қамтамасыз ету үшін электромагниттік индукцияны қолданады. Ең көп таралған қолданба - Qi сымсыз зарядтау
Guardian V1.0 --- Arduino көмегімен есік саңылауы камерасын жаңарту (қозғалысты анықтау және электр тогының соғу мүмкіндіктері): 5 қадам
Guardian V1.0 ||| Ардуино көмегімен есік тесік камерасын жаңарту (қозғалысты анықтау және электр тогының соғу мүмкіндіктері): Мен саңылау камерасына тапсырыс бердім, бірақ мен оны қолданған кезде автоматты түрде жазу функциясы жоқ екенін түсіндім (қозғалысты анықтау арқылы іске қосылады). Содан кейін мен оның қалай жұмыс істейтінін зерттей бастадым. Бейне жазу үшін сізге 1- қуат түймесін 2 секундтай басып тұру керек